background background
Ambrocio Defontorum

Ambrocio Defontorum (1981)N/A

None · Philippines · Tagalog, Filipino · Nov 8, 1981 (PH) · More  
Directed by:  Bert R. Mendoza
Review
Rate
Watch
Watchlist